Output e63ca20f63efba8eba705c50b105eaffef21fec1596f5f1c9d8ec2bc6b5dae33:0

value
1517667
script pubkey
OP_0 OP_PUSHBYTES_20 4efe98841733d277d11849fec6ba7e5eafc381b0
address
bc1qfmlf3pqhx0f805gcf8lvdwn7t6hu8qdsw6en29
transaction
e63ca20f63efba8eba705c50b105eaffef21fec1596f5f1c9d8ec2bc6b5dae33
confirmations
149464
spent
true